A viral video was caught on camera at a zoo in Northern China, where a lioness suddenly lunged at a toddler standing just inches away — separated only by a pane of glass. The toddler, oblivious to the looming danger, stood with his back turned, while the lioness crept up and pounced with full force.
The thick glass barrier was the only thing that prevented a tragedy, sending shockwaves through onlookers and sparking intense debate online. What some initially mistook for a playful moment quickly turned into a chilling reminder of nature’s raw instincts and the critical importance of zoo safety measures.
Pubity recently shared a reel on Instagram capturing a chilling yet strangely amusing moment — a lioness lunging at a toddler standing just behind a zoo glass barrier. In the clip, the lioness silently creeps up before leaping and slamming into the glass with full force, startling viewers. The child, unaware of the danger, remains safely behind the transparent shield.
In a second attempt, the lioness tries again to reach the toddler, showcasing her natural hunting instincts. Fortunately, the glass holds firm, preventing what could have been a horrifying incident.
